Understand the three core AI music video formats

Aspect ratio controls the shape of the frame, not the quality of the music or video by itself. The complete guide to ai music video formats starts with a simple decision: where will people watch, and what must remain visible? Once you answer that, you can plan shots that feel intentional rather than squeezed into a late export.

What 9:16 means for vertical short-form video

A 9:16 video is taller than it is wide, matching the way people hold a phone. It gives a singer, dancer, portrait, or central character room to fill the screen, but it leaves less space for wide group scenes and long captions. Keep the main action near the center and check how platform controls may cover the lower and upper edges.

Vertical video benefits from close framing and clear movement. A face, microphone, or lyric line can read quickly when the subject occupies much of the frame, while distant scenery may lose its effect on a small display.

How 1:1 works for square social media posts

A 1:1 video gives you equal height and width, so the composition feels stable in a social feed. It works well when one character, product, or album image needs equal breathing room on every side. You can also use it when your audience may view the post from several feed layouts.

Square framing asks you to simplify. Place the main subject close enough to read, then leave a controlled margin for captions and interface elements rather than filling every corner.

When 16:9 is the right choice for widescreen video

A 16:9 frame suits YouTube, websites, desktop screens, and connected TV. It gives you room for landscapes, band formations, two-person scenes, and wider narrative shots. The tradeoff is that a phone viewer may see the video reduced inside a vertical feed.

Use horizontal framing when the song depends on setting, travel, choreography across the frame, or a cinematic sense of distance. Wide shots should still have a clear focal point, even when the scene contains several visual details.

Compare aspect ratio, resolution, and viewing experience

Aspect ratio describes the frame shape; resolution describes the number of pixels; viewing experience describes how the audience encounters the result. A large file can still feel poorly composed if a face sits at the edge or text becomes tiny after conversion. For a useful comparison of the three common shapes, see this format overview.

Format Typical use Main strength Common risk
9:16 Short-form mobile video Full-screen phone viewing Cropped wide scenes
1:1 Social feed posts Balanced square composition Less room for groups
16:9 YouTube and widescreen playback Broad cinematic framing Smaller display in vertical feeds

The table is a planning guide, not a rulebook. Match the shape to the viewing situation first, then choose a resolution that keeps faces, motion, and text clear after upload.

Choose the right format for each platform

Your distribution plan should influence generation, not just export. Each platform gives the audience a different amount of screen space and attention, so a strong video may need more than one composition. Plan a primary version, then decide which scenes can be reframed without losing their point.

Vertical square and widescreen music video layouts

Match 9:16 videos with TikTok, Instagram Reels, and YouTube Shorts

Use 9:16 when the video will appear as a full-screen short on TikTok, Instagram Reels, or YouTube Shorts. Put the singer, face, or key action in a tall composition, and keep important lyrics away from the bottom controls. Fast openings work better when the first visual reads immediately on a phone.

Use 1:1 for Instagram feeds, social posts, and product content

Square video is useful when the post must sit comfortably in a traditional feed. It gives you a dependable middle ground for portraits, simple performance clips, product scenes, and cover-art motion. Keep the subject large enough to survive the smaller preview that many feeds show before playback.

Publish 16:9 videos on YouTube, websites, and connected TV

Choose 16:9 when the screen is likely to be horizontal and the setting matters. You can stage a performer against a broad background, place several subjects in one shot, or let a camera move through a larger environment. Repurpose one music video across multiple platforms

Repurposing works best when you treat each version as a deliberate edit. Do not assume one crop will preserve the same story, because the focal point may move out of frame or captions may become unreadable. A platform plan can include:

  • One primary version built for the channel with the largest audience.
  • A reframed cut that moves the subject rather than only trimming the edges.
  • Short excerpts with their own opening moments and lyric selections.
  • A square version for feeds where a full-screen vertical post is not the goal.

After each version renders, watch it on the device and platform where it will appear. That final check often reveals problems that are invisible in the editing window.

Plan visuals around the selected aspect ratio

A good prompt cannot rescue a composition that ignores the frame. Decide where the viewer should look, what must remain visible, and how text will behave before you generate the first scene. This makes later revisions smaller and keeps the video visually consistent from start to finish.

Keep faces, lyrics, and key subjects inside the safe area

Treat the middle portion of the frame as your safe area for faces, instruments, lyrics, and logos. Leave extra space near platform controls, since interface elements can cover content near the edges. This is especially important for vertical video, where a subject can be tall but still too close to the top or bottom.

When a lyric matters, place it where the eye can find it without blocking the performance. Use a preview with interface overlays if the platform provides one, then check the exported file again.

Adapt camera framing for vertical, square, and widescreen layouts

A vertical close-up may become a square medium shot and a horizontal wide shot may need an entirely different arrangement. Write prompts that name the framing you want, such as centered portrait, waist-up performance, or wide two-person composition. Avoid asking one scene to carry every shape without adjustment.

Design text overlays for mobile readability

Use short lines, strong contrast, and generous spacing. Lyrics should not depend on tiny type or long blocks that move too quickly for a phone viewer. Test the text at the size your audience will actually see, not only at full editing resolution.

Keep one caption idea per beat or phrase when possible. If a line is long, split it across moments that follow the vocal rather than shrinking the whole sentence to fit.

Use movement and transitions that work across screen shapes

Movement should guide attention toward the center of the active frame. Slow camera pushes, controlled pans, and beat-matched cuts usually survive reframing better than action that runs from one extreme edge to another. Let transitions follow the song’s energy, but give each shot enough time to register.

A vertical version may need fewer background details and larger gestures, while a widescreen version can support longer lateral movement. Generate with those differences in mind instead of treating them as export problems.

Prepare music and prompts before generating the video

The quality of the first result depends on the clarity of the input. Gather the track, decide the audience, describe the visual direction, and mark the moments that deserve a scene change. This preparation also makes it easier to compare multiple aspect ratios without losing the song’s identity.

Write prompts that define genre, mood, story, and visual style

A useful prompt gives the system a clear subject, setting, action, lighting direction, mood, and visual treatment. Add the intended aspect ratio and framing when the tool accepts those details. Keep the first prompt focused, then revise one variable at a time so you can tell what changed.

Align scene changes with beats, vocals, and song structure

Mark the intro, verse, chorus, bridge, drop, and outro before you generate. Use stronger motion or a new setting when the song changes energy, and hold a consistent visual idea through a vocal phrase. The result feels more connected when the edit follows musical structure instead of switching scenes at random.

Decide whether the video needs performance, narrative, or abstract visuals

Performance visuals keep attention on a singer or character. Narrative scenes give the song a sequence of events, while abstract visuals can respond to energy, rhythm, and color without a literal plot. Choose one main mode first, then add another only when the song benefits from the change.

A steady visual language matters more than filling every second with new imagery. Repeat a location, color family, character detail, or camera style so the track feels like one piece.

Review timing, lip-sync, captions, and visual continuity

Watch the video once with sound and once without it. Look for mouths that drift from the vocal, captions that arrive late, abrupt changes in character appearance, and cuts that ignore the song’s phrasing. Fix the largest continuity problem first, then refine small visual details.

A useful review also checks whether the opening communicates the song’s mood quickly. If the first scene takes too long to establish the subject, shorten it or begin with a stronger musical moment.

Select resolution, frame rate, and file settings

Choose a resolution that suits the platform and the source quality. Keep the frame rate consistent with the project when possible, and use a file format accepted by the intended channel. Higher pixel dimensions do not automatically fix soft faces, unstable motion, or poor source material.

Record the settings for each version so you can reproduce a clean export later. Check the finished file rather than assuming the export panel tells the whole story.

Reframe scenes instead of simply cropping the original video

Move the subject, resize the shot, or generate a separate composition when a crop removes the visual point. A horizontal group scene may need a vertical close-up, and a tall portrait may need a new background arrangement for widescreen. Reframing takes more care, but it preserves the intended action.

Check captions, logos, and subjects after format conversion

Review every caption for position, size, and timing. Make sure logos remain inside the safe area and that faces, hands, instruments, and other important subjects have not shifted behind an edge. Watch at normal speed because some problems only appear when the video moves.

Do not rely on a still frame alone. A transition can push a subject into a blocked area even when the opening frame looks perfect.

Export separate versions for each distribution channel

Name files by aspect ratio and destination so you do not upload the wrong cut. Keep a clean master, then export dedicated versions for short-form platforms, social feeds, and widescreen playback. If the song has several promotional moments, create short excerpts from the master rather than shrinking the full video into every channel.

A separate export also lets you change the opening, caption placement, or shot order for the audience without damaging the main project.

Improve quality and avoid common format mistakes

Most format problems appear before the final upload. A subject sits too close to an edge, a caption becomes unreadable, or a sequence moves faster than the song can support. Slow down the review, make targeted changes, and treat licensing as part of the release plan.

Prevent cropped faces, instruments, and important visual details

Keep a margin around anything the viewer must see. Wide instruments and full-body movement need special attention in 9:16, while small faces can disappear in 16:9. Generate alternate close-ups when a crop cannot preserve the action naturally.

Fix empty space and awkward composition in vertical videos

Empty space is not always a problem, but accidental empty space makes a vertical video feel unfinished. Bring the subject closer, add a purposeful foreground element, or change the camera angle. Do not fill every gap with random motion that competes with the song.

Balance visual intensity with the song’s pacing

Fast cuts can support a high-energy section, but constant motion makes a quiet verse feel noisy. Match shot length, camera movement, and color changes to the track’s structure. A restrained moment can make the next chorus feel larger without relying on visual overload.

Check compression, audio levels, and platform upload limits

Play the exported file on a phone, computer, and headphones when possible. Listen for clipping, sudden level changes, missing audio, or compression artifacts in dark scenes. Then check the current upload limits for the destination before you publish.

Review licensing and commercial-use requirements for AI-generated music and visuals

Read the terms attached to the tool, source track, characters, images, voices, and music before commercial release. Rights can depend on the input, plan, territory, and intended use. Keep records of your prompts, uploads, licenses, and final exports.
